lowering springs

Featured Replies

Hi

Has anyone fitted lowering springs to a fiesta mk 6.5 is it an easy job?

Very easy on the Mk6, rear springs just drop out once the lower shock bolts have been removed and the beam swings down.

Fronts are the same as most cars these days, strut needs to be removed, then spring compressed and top nut removed.  Lift off top mount, fit lower spring (don't usually need to compress them) and push the top mount on while fitting the top nut.  Then refit the strut to the car.
